Okay, this week-end some riders will see and ride the third new model in Cervinia (Italy).
Thus we can't keep it secret any longer. :D Here is how it looks.

Model name is: Extremecarver Pro

All details and program will be given soon. This is made by hand, in limited series in our new R&D workshop. The board will be available only online from mid-December.

Since the model Extremecarver Pro is new, made in limited series by hand in our small R&D workshop (it's like custom board), there won't be demo boards so early (and maybe never). People have to find a friend or someone who has it. ;-)

The other model, Extremecarver Gen4, is made now in a new factory and brings the Swoard-EC technique to a wide public, from beginners to experts.

Watch out, metal has advantages... but also inconveniences, which Swoard wanted to by-pass by developing an innovative technology (for 4-5 years). We shall talk again about this later this winter.

The construction is not "classic" with simple sheets of Titanal (= alloy of aluminum), but much more complex. Note that metal is used in the ski industry for 30 years at least. Thus it is not so new and there is quite a lot of marketing made recently on metal.

Swoard does not follow the trends. Swoard creates them. ;-)
Whether this is in board concept or in ride technique. Because we make all this to have the best boards for ourselves above all, in the style of ride that we created. We are a small team which is free to make what it wants because we make it by passion, besides our other jobs and thus without financial constraints.

:arrow: The price of the model could be determined this summer already, on the basis of the hand-made stages and of the complexity (with regard to the "standard metal"). It was fixed to 859€ free of tax. For comparison the Extremecarver Gen4 is 639€ free of tax, and the Dual is 549€ free of tax.

We believe that this price for an innovative metal technology is very competitive with regard to all what is produced in Europe with metal.
